The Baxter Drive residence of Nicholas Lee Walsh, Sam Leon Sports and Priscilla Nicole Pearson was burglarized between 10 a.m. and 1 p.m. June 30. A handgun, cameras, and iPod with a total value of $1,380 were stolen. Walsh said when he entered the residence he encountered a white male walking toward him. The male told him he was a maintenance man and left. After he left, the items were found missing. He was described as in his 20s, 5-foot-10 to 5-foot-11, 140 to 160 pounds, and wearing a white work shirt and blue pants.
